1. Introduction
WD112 is a hosted IoE Smart Network module that enables wireless internet connectivity for any
device wishing to be monitored or managed remotely. The WD112 is architected for ultra-low
power consumption, with near-zero power consumption in power down modes with fast wakeup.
This module comes with a single band 1-stream 11n radio Qualcomm QCA4002 and a ST
STM32F411 processor in ARM Cortex-M4 operating at frequencies up to 100MHz. This module
has an extra 2MByte flash memory, in addition to the flash memory internal to the MPU.
2. Features
2.412-2.484 GHz for worldwide market.
IEEE 802.11n, single stream 1x1.
Single Rx front end for multiple applications.
Full security support: WPS, WPA, WPA2, WAPI, WEP, TKIP.
On-chip memory
Serial interfaces: 3x USART, 2x SPI, 3x I2C
ROM API support
3 low-power modes and wake-up from low-power modes

3. Specification
802.11n hosted IoE module
Flash: 2MB External to MCU, 512KB internal to MCU
128KB SRAM internal to MCU.
IEEE 802.11b DSSS and 802.11g/n OFDM
11 (US), 13 (EU), 14 (Japan)
802.11n: up to 135Mbps
802.11g: 54Mbps with fallback to 48, 36, 24, 18, 12, 9 and
6Mbps
802.11b: 11Mbps with fallback to 5.5, 1 and 1Mbps
802.11g/n:
64QAM (up to 135Mbps),
16QAM (39/36/26/24Mbps),
QPSK (19.5/18/13/12Mbps),
BPSK (9/6.5/6Mbps)
802.11b:
CCK (11/5.5Mbps), DQPSK (2Mbps), DBPSK (1Mbps)
-90dBm for 1Mbps @ 8% PER
-82dBm for 11Mbps @ 8% PER
-72dBm for 54Mbps @ 10% PER
-67dBm for HT40, MCS7 @ 10% PER

Power Requirements (typical)
Tx mode :
11Mbps: 240mA
54Mbps: 210mA
135Mbps: 220mA
Rx mode :
11Mbps: 62mA
54Mbps: 62mA
135Mbps: 62mA
ROM API Support:
Boot loader with boot options from flash or external
source via USART
